The Modern Gym Problem: Why Recovery Matters More Than Ever
Today's fitness culture celebrates the "no pain, no gain" mentality, but science tells a different story. Your muscles don't grow in the gym they grow during recovery. When you exercise, you create micro-tears in muscle fibers and trigger inflammation. Your body then repairs these tears, making muscles stronger and more resilient. This process takes time, energy, and the right nutrients.
Delayed Onset Muscle Soreness (DOMS) peaks between 24-72 hours post-workout, reducing your strength, range of motion, and motivation to train consistently. Meanwhile, your cellular energy systems (ATP production) get depleted, leaving you feeling mentally foggy and physically exhausted for days. Add to this the cumulative stress of modern life work pressure, sleep debt, inadequate nutrition—and your recovery systems become overwhelmed.

Shilajit vs. Creatine: The Recovery Comparison Every Gym-Goer Should Know
Both Shilajit and Creatine are popular supplements, but they work through fundamentally different mechanisms. Here's how they compare:

Key Differences in Action:
Shilajit boosts energy through improved mitochondrial function and steady ATP production, supporting longer workouts with sustained energy levels. Creatine rapidly regenerates ATP through phosphocreatine stores, making it more effective for high-intensity bursts of power.
Best Use Cases:
Choose Shilajit if you: Do endurance training, need comprehensive health benefits, seek hormonal balance, want broader wellness support, or prefer natural adaptogenic supplements.
Choose Creatine if you: Focus on strength training, want proven muscle mass gains, need explosive power, prefer research-backed strength gains, or prioritize muscle hypertrophy.
The Ideal Approach: Many advanced athletes take both supplements—Shilajit (250-500 mg daily) for sustained mitochondrial support and recovery, combined with Creatine (3-5 g daily) for high-intensity performance. They work through different pathways without adverse interactions, creating comprehensive performance enhancement.
